Many In High-Risk Insurance Pools Face Lifetime Coverage Limits
Despite the federal overhaul of health care, people in the pools are left out because of a wrinkle in legal language. The high-risk pools aren't licensed as insurers in most states, so they're not subject to the federal law.
For Hungarian Borrowers, A Mortgage Nightmare
In better times, ordinary Hungarians flocked to low-interest mortgages denominated in Swiss francs. Then, the Hungarian currency crashed and the franc soared, and now 1 million Hungarians face exorbitant payments on properties that have lost value.

Campaigns Embrace Twitter: Who Let The Snark Out?
Twitter has become the latest medium for campaign spin. It's a stream of barbs over debates, crowd estimates and ad wars. And even the candidates' dogs are not off-limits.
Signing Day: Like Christmas For College Sports
On National Signing Day, high school seniors can officially plight their troth to a college football program. And that means grown-up college football zealots are acting like kids at Christmas: "Who will Santa bring to my alma mater's team?"

Romney Leads Gingrich In Money; Obama Bests Both
Newt Gingrich had his best fundraising of the campaign in the final months of last year — but so did rival Mitt Romney, whose disclosure reports showed he raised more than twice as much. As for Obama, his campaign showed that incumbency still has its advantages.

In Booming Istanbul, A Clash Between Old And New
Istanbul is rapidly changing as Turkey's economy surges. Working-class neighborhoods are being cleared to make room for expensive villas, luxury hotels and upscale restaurants. A new documentary film warns that the latest mega-projects will damage the social and cultural fabric of the city.

Cystic Fibrosis Drug Wins Approval
The Food and Drug Administration approved the first drug that treats cystic fibrosis by addressing an underlying cause of the disease. But the medicine, called Kalydeco, will cost nearly $300,000 a year.

Despite Florida, GOP Concerns About Romney Linger
Mitt Romney's huge win in Florida positions him well for the contests ahead. The only thing the Florida outcome failed to do, some critics maintain, was present a convincing case that Romney is the best possible Republican candidate to take on President Obama.
After Mitt Romney's Decisive Victory, What Will Newt Gingrich Do?
Though Gingrich vowed to take the campaign into the summer, analysts say after his Florida loss, he might have to recalibrate.
Pakistan Denies NATO Report Connecting It To Afghan Taliban
The report, based on interrogations with captured fighters, says Taliban leaders are intimately involved with Pakistan's intelligence agency. "The Taliban are not Islam. The Taliban are Islamabad," one detainee is quoted as saying.
